Daiquiri is a rum-based cocktail with lime juice and sugar whose alcohol and fructose content raise gout flare risk despite low purines.

Added by vblinden

Good
  • Distilled rum and lime juice contribute minimal purines compared to beer or high-purine foods.
Bad
  • Alcohol reduces uric acid excretion by the kidneys while added sugar/fructose promotes uric acid production, increasing inflammation and flare likelihood.
